Hyaluronic Acid Promotes the Osteogenesis of BMP-2 in an Absorbable Collagen Sponge

Abstract: (1) Background: We tested the hypothesis that hyaluronic acid (HA) can significantly promote the osteogenic potential of BMP-2/ACS (absorbable collagen sponge), an efficacious product to heal large oral bone defects, thereby allowing its use at lower dosages and, thus, reducing its side-effects due to the unphysiologically-high doses of BMP-2; (2) Methods: In a subcutaneous bone induction model in rats, we first sorted out the optimal HA-polymer size and concentration with micro CT. “…In vivo, application of HA for bone regeneration has been demonstrated in craniofacial bone defects in various animal models [18]. To stimulate bone formation, HA is either (1) mixed with filler materials [9,10,[19][20][21], (2) applied as a coating material [22], or (3) used as a carrier of growth factors and cells in the bone defect [23][24][25]. However, to date, only few clinical studies exist on the use of HA in reconstructive periodontal surgery [26][27][28][29][30].…”

“…Several studies have examined HA hydrogels for their potential as carriers for BMP-2. Injectable or implantable HA hydrogels retain BMP-2 and stimulate bone formation in vivo [ 17 , 21 27 ]. Implantation of acrylated HA hydrogel with BMP-2 accelerates bone repair in calvarial defects in rats, and injectable hydrazone-crosslinked HA hydrogels with BMP-2 stimulate bone formation in rat calvaria [ 28 ].…”

“…Glycosaminoglycans (GAGs) have been shown to improve BMP-2 bioactivity, including for obtaining the intended osteogenesis effects [ 17 ]. HA, a type of GAG, comprises linear polysaccharides made up of repeating disaccharide units of amino sugars and uronic acid, and is among the most used materials for enhancing the microenvironment for BMP-induced osteogenesis.…”
